Eliot Candee Clark  American  1883 -1980
Examples of Work: Dayton Art Institute, Ohio 
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York 
National Academy of Design 
Smithsonian American Art Museum, Washington, D.C. 
Fort Worth Museum, Texas 
Maryland Institute, Baltimore 
Specialty: Painter
Instructor
Style/School: Impressionism
Realism
Subjects Known For: Landscapes
Memberships: National Academy of Design p. ANA 1917; NA 1944; PNAD 1956-59
Allied Artists of America 
American Watercolor Society 
Art Fund Society 
Connecticut Academy of Fine Arts 
National Arts Club 
Teaching Positions: Art Students League, New York City

BIOGRAPHY:
Eliot Clark was the son of painter Walter Clark (1848-1917). "As a child," he later wrote, "I grew unconsciously in the association of artists, of studio talk and the smell of paint and turpentine."1 His earliest memories of his father's studio were when it was in the Holbein ... (More)
